Output 3d683dd4a5fe892b31a22b3150fced1f27f6dad9779e2304325560d0dc66d68f:1

value
3672194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ba2a3c481be89995605c6d4a14d749a08bd5110 OP_EQUAL
address
2N8tkNVXQkQxEeGHqjRtzAH2mdeABLX8GhH
transaction
3d683dd4a5fe892b31a22b3150fced1f27f6dad9779e2304325560d0dc66d68f